Full Form, Stands For & Short Meaning of STFU

The full form of STFU is “Shut The F*** Up.” It is considered an offensive slang expression and is mostly used in informal digital communication. The phrase is shortened into an acronym to make it less direct while still expressing strong emotion.

In texting culture, STFU is often used to show annoyance, disbelief, or joking frustration among close friends. However, it should be avoided in formal or professional conversations due to its rude nature.

Short meaning:

STFU simply means asking someone to stop talking immediately, usually in a strong or emotional tone.

Origin, History & First Known Use of STFU

The origin of STFU dates back to early internet chatrooms, forums, and online gaming communities in the late 1990s and early 2000s. As digital communication evolved, users began shortening phrases for faster typing.

STFU became popular in IRC chats and multiplayer games where quick reactions were needed. Over time, it spread to social media platforms and texting culture. Today, it is recognized globally as part of internet slang, especially among younger users who prefer fast, expressive communication styles.

Examples of STFU in Real Chat Situations

STFU appears in many real-life chat scenarios, especially in informal conversations. For example, friends joking during gaming may say “STFU, I can’t believe that move!” In another case, someone reacting to shocking news might type “STFU, seriously?”

These examples show that tone and relationship matter a lot. Without context, the same phrase can be funny or rude. That is why understanding usage is important in digital communication today.
